Figs. 162–183 in Classification, Natural History, And Evolution Of The Genus Aphelocerus Kirsch (Coleoptera: Cleridae: Clerinae)

Figs. 162–183. Aedeagus, habitus, elytral discal setal tufts. 162. Aphelocerus dispilis, aedeagus. 163. Weevil, Myrmex sp. 164. Aphelocerus myrmecoides, 165–183. Elytral discal setal tufts. 165. A. sagittarius. 166. A. triangulus. 167. A. cornuatus. 168. A. humerus. 169. A. acutus. 170. A. lividus. 171. A. protenus. 172. A. argus. 173. A. arenatus. 174. A. catie. 175. A. chiriqui. 176. A. yungas. 177. A. monteverde. 178. A. anticus. 179. A. batesi. 180. A. bufustis. 181. A. acanthus. 182. A. yungas. 183. A. sturnus.
